Well, if you have a B16, then you just pull the main 15amp ECU fuse for a few minutes. You can also disconnect your negative battery terminal for a few minutes.
This will only "reset" your ECU. Personally, I have never found a reason to do this. If you want to "clear your codes", you will need some sort of OBD tool/scanner. Some emissions related codes will remain until they are cleared.
